The Sable Marionettist
The Sable Marionettist is not merely a title but the embodiment of an enigma wrapped in the shadows of the mystical realm of Aetheria. Cloaked in obsidian robes that ripple like the night sky without stars, the Sable Marionettist is a figure of intrigue and whispered legends. Some say that the marionettist is as old as time itself, a puppeteer of fate who can pull the strings of destiny, weaving the future with the deftness of a spider spinning its web.
No one has seen the true face of the Sable Marionettist, for it is hidden behind a mask that is as emotionless as it is timeless, carved from the darkest ebony wood and polished to a reflective sheen. Rumors abound that the mask itself is imbued with magic, capable of casting illusions or peering into the soul of any who dare meet its gaze. The Sable Marionettist is known to traverse the lands with a troupe of marionettes, each crafted with such artistry and imbued with such arcane essence that they appear to live and breathe. These puppets perform tales of ancient lore and forgotten truths, leaving audiences mesmerized and often, changed.
The origin of this mysterious entity is a tapestry of tales, each more fantastical than the last. Some speak of a sorcerer whose love for the puppeteering arts turned into an obsession that transcended mortality. Others whisper of a spirit bound to the physical realm, its purpose to guide the threads of life through the medium of its enchanted puppets. There are even those who believe the marionettist to be a deity in disguise, teaching mortals the complexities of existence through allegorical performances.
The Sable Marionettist's reputation is a blend of fear and awe. It is said that to witness a performance is to glimpse the truths of the universe, for the marionettist's shows are replete with enigmatic wisdom and esoteric knowledge. Despite the air of menace that surrounds the figure, there is also a sense of profound understanding and compassion, as if its purpose is to enlighten rather than to terrify.
However, the most tantalizing aspect of the Sable Marionettist remains its collection of marionettes. Crafted from materials that are rumored to be sourced from the very fabric of the Aetheria, each puppet is said to possess a fragment of a soul, giving them a semblance of life that is both wondrous and unsettling. The marionettist's skill in manipulating these marionettes is unparalleled, their movements so fluid and lifelike that they could be mistaken for living creatures.
Enigmatic Performances
The performances of the Sable Marionettist are as varied as the stars in the firmament, each show a unique spectacle that is never replicated. It is said that each performance is a reflection of the souls present in the audience, a mirror to their deepest desires and darkest fears. The marionettes dance upon the stage, their strings invisible, in tales that evoke the full spectrum of emotion from those who watch. The air itself seems to thrum with magic as the puppets move, and the atmosphere becomes charged with an otherworldly energy.

The locations chosen for these performances are as enigmatic as the marionettist itself. A moonlit clearing in an ancient forest, the ruins of a forgotten castle, or the center of a deserted town square can become the stage for the night's mysteries. The Sable Marionettist appears without announcement or fanfare, and those who are meant to witness the performance are somehow drawn to the location as if by a siren's call.
Some say that during these performances, the veil between the material plane and the ethereal realms grows thin, allowing glimpses of other worlds and times long past—or yet to come. The narratives spun by the marionettes are complex, weaving history, prophecy, and allegory into a tapestry that leaves the audience pondering long after the final bow. The performances can be hauntingly beautiful or unsettling in their intensity, but they are always unforgettable.
One particular performance is often spoken of in hushed tones—the "Dance of the Five Moons." In it, five marionettes, each representing a phase of the moon, enact a ritual of balance and renewal. As the story unfolds, the audience experiences a collective journey through cycles of growth, loss, and rebirth. It is rumored that those who witness the "Dance of the Five Moons" emerge with a newfound understanding of their place in the cosmos.
Another legendary show, "The Lament of the Forgotten King," tells the story of a ruler whose pride led to his kingdom's downfall. The marionettes in this piece are garbed in regal attire, now tattered and worn, moving with a solemn grace that can bring tears to the eyes of the onlookers. The tale serves as a warning against hubris, and many a ruler has been seen attending these performances, hoping to glean wisdom from the cautionary fable.
The Sable Marionettist never speaks during these performances, communicating solely through the movement of the puppets and the ambient music that seems to emanate from an unseen source. The music is an integral part of the spectacle, shifting seamlessly from haunting melodies to rousing crescendos that underscore the unfolding drama.
As the final act draws to a close and the marionettes take their last, graceful twirl upon the stage, the Sable Marionettist gathers them up and disappears as mysteriously as they arrived. No applause is sought, and none is given, for the silence that follows is a part of the performance—a moment for reflection and introspection. Those who have experienced the magic of the Sable Marionettist's enigmatic performances carry away with them a piece of the mystery, forever changed by what they have seen and felt beneath the puppeteer's masterful hands.
